Meeting notes — Dispatch briefing, Thursday

Attendees: R. Calvane, T. Ostrev.

Sealed exam papers for the Merridock Institute spring sitting arrive Friday 07:00. One tamper-evident crate. Store in the locked cage, no exceptions. Seals must not be broken at any stage. Courier pickup booked for 09:30 sharp with Fennwick Express. At hand-over, apply the confidential instruction stated below.

courier memo of hafop-bagep: the pelwyn quenys courier leaves the casir oliwyn casix weniel jorwyn ralwyn briix isteth ledger at gate 3637 under passcode 492304

Action item from the Calverton formula-engine incident: user-supplied formulas now run in a sandboxed evaluator with hard limits on execution time, recursion depth, and memory. Support should expect tickets about formulas that previously worked but now hit a cap; point customers to the limits page. The enforced limits are the following constants.

tuning table, hafog-bahaf:
QUOTAS = {
    "praion": 144,
    "briax": 906,
    "silwyn": 451,
}

# Heads up for release: this constant pins the locale-extraction script version
# used by the Vollerby string sweep. If the sweep and the app bundle drift apart,
# translators at Quenmark get stale keys and we all have a bad week. Bump it only
# after a full extraction run passes. The matching build token goes right below.

pipeline stamp: htk3_69f

## SDK Parity Check — Brambleworks

Hey plugin folks — before shipping, run the parity harness to confirm your plugin behaves the same on the Swift and Kotlin SDKs. Set PARITY_TARGET=both and pin PARITY_SDK_VERSION to the release you target. The harness pulls fixtures from our registry, which needs a credential, set on the next line.

vault entry, kafog-yahop: COURIER_KEY8=0faa53ae